Gas Grill Buying Tips


Gas grills are a choice that is popular barbecue enthusiasts. Due to the fact compared to charcoal grills, gas grills are easier to clean. In addition, there are lower accidents associated to the usage of fuel grills and in ten minutes it is ready to barbecue. For those thinking of buying a gas grill or updating up to a fuel grill for grilling, there are always a wide range of facts to consider before purchasing one. Taking these few tips into consideration will make the search faster and easier, and the grill you purchase may well be more satisfying to work with.

1. Three Types Of Gas Grills


Entry-level

These gas grills are the most basic available into the market today. They are reasonable priced starting at $ 150 to $ 300. Entry-level gas grills don't need wood or charcoal and produce their own temperature. With regards to this sort of gas grill, it is advisable to choose one made of metal for the frame and body that is main.
Mid-Range

These gas grills on the other hand really are a little more expensive but also offer more features compared to gas grill that is basic. Rates for mid-range gas grills range from $ 350 to $ 1150. Of these kinds of gas grills it's always best to select those made by established manufacturers to be able to get an excellent item.
Deluxe Models

These gas grills will be the cream of the crop with prices beginning at $ 1500 and many models going for more than $ 5000. High-end gas grills often make use of big BTU ratings as a feature for them. However the brand and materials of the gasoline grill should function as the main concern whenever buying a model gas grill that is deluxe.

2. Basic Elements Of A Gas Grill


The basic framework of most gas grills offered available in the market is rather straightforward. The burners produce heat and some type of heat dispersal system is above the burners. Together with all this are the cooking grates where the foodstuff is put. The equipment within the bonnet is exactly what separates a typical fuel grill from a gas grill that is excellent. {a gas grill which includes at least two or more individual burners allow for greater heat control. This gives for even heat over the cooking surface thus producing better tasting food. Drippings cannot be prevented whenever barbecuing, however this causes flare-ups. Particular gas grills have systems to regulate flare-ups and transform it into flavorful smoke to enhance the flavor of the food.

3. Understanding BTU


Most gas grills sold on the market usage BTUs as the selling that is main of product. However most people don't understand the relevance of BTUs up to a fuel grill, not to mention the meaning of BTU. BTU means British unit that is thermal which indicates the quantity of gas that the gas grill is able to burn. With fuel grills, sometimes less BTU are better since it allows for food to prepare more proficiently. Too much of it can damage the burners and cut quick the full life regarding the gas grill. But for larger grills, having greater BTUs is best in an effort to pay for the larger cooking area.

4. Check For Solid Construction


It is important to decide on a gas grill with a stable and construction that is solid. A poorly built gas grill gets the propensity to wiggle and may also falter once emerge spot. Avoid purchasing a gas grill that isn't shown in the sales floor, ensure that there is a display available to manage to check the stability out associated with the gas grill before purchasing it. Choose a gas grill that is crafted of high-grade U.S. Steel and also go with a gasoline grill with a baked-on, porcelain enamel finish. Check that the grates are built from either cast iron, porcelain-coated cast iron or aluminum and stainless steel.

5. Gas Grill Maintenance


When buying a gas grill it is essential to start thinking about the quantity of maintenance required to keep it running for years to come. Select a brand of gas grill that provides simple yet comprehensive product information and offers a customer service line that is toll-free. Check if the brand offer trouble-free access to parts and services and also a dealer network that is reliable.
